The death of Prince: One year later, what do we know?

Almost one year to the day of his demise, the late superstar Prince Rogers Nelson remains as enigmatic in death as he often was in life.

This has compounded the shock and sorrow of his departure for his fans, still wondering why he died of an opioid overdose and why his multimillion-dollar estate is still such a mess.

"Contradictions and seeming inconsistencies are part and parcel of (Prince's) whole story — nothing is simple or self-evident," says Alex Hahn, a Boston lawyer, Prince fan and co-author of The Rise of Prince:1958-1988. "With someone like Elvis Presley or Kurt Cobain or Amy Winehouse, there is an unambiguous picture of physical or psychological deterioration as part of substance abuse. Prince died of an overdose but he doesn't have these other (signs) in common with them."

"There's a lot of mystery, a lot of information behind the curtain," says Frank Wheaton, a lawyer who, up until last month, represented one of Prince's siblings and presumed heirs, one of an army of lawyers involved in the case.

The curtain is likely to remain closed for the time being.
